INITIATING DEVICE CIRCUIT (IDC)

INSTALLATION

EQ22xxIDC SERIES INITIATING DEvICE CIRCUIT
(IDC)

The following paragraphs describe how to properly

install the EQ22xxIDC Initiating Device Circuit.

Mounting
The device should be securely mounted to a vibration

free surface. (See “Specifications” in this manual for

device dimensions.)

WARNING!

The hazardous area must be de-classified prior
to removing a junction box cover with power
applied.

Wiring
1. Remove the cover from the device junction box.

2. Connect external system wiring to the appropriate

terminals on the terminal block. (See Figure 3-4

for terminal block location and Figure 3-5 for

terminal identification). The input to the IDC

consists of one or more normally open switches

(momentary pushbuttons are not recommended),

with a 10K ohm, 1/4 watt EOL resistor in parallel

across the furthest switch from the input.

IMPORTANT!

An EOL resistor must be installed on both IDC
inputs (including unused inputs). Wiring
impedance must not exceed 500 ohms.

3. Check wiring to ensure that ALL connections have

been properly made.

IMPORTANT!

Be sure that the keyed ribbon cable is properly
connected to the terminal board.

4. Inspect the junction box O-ring to be sure that it is

in good condition.

5. Lubricate the O-ring and the threads of the

junction box cover with a thin coat of grease to

ease installation and ensure a watertight

enclosure.
